> +/**
> + * get_ipv6_ext_hdrs() - Parses packet and sets IPv6 extension header flags.
> + *
> + * @skb: buffer where extension header data starts in packet
> + * @nh: ipv6 header
> + * @ext_hdrs: flags are stored here
> + *
> + * OFPIEH12_UNREP is set if more than one of a given IPv6 extension header
> + * is unexpectedly encountered. (Two destination options headers may be
> + * expected and would not cause this bit to be set.)
> + *
> + * OFPIEH12_UNSEQ is set if IPv6 extension headers were not in the order
> + * preferred (but not required) by RFC 2460:
> + *
> + * When more than one extension header is used in the same packet, it is
> + * recommended that those headers appear in the following order:
> + * IPv6 header
> + * Hop-by-Hop Options header
> + * Destination Options header
> + * Routing header
> + * Fragment header
> + * Authentication header
> + * Encapsulating Security Payload header
> + * Destination Options header
> + * upper-layer header
> + */
